RSVP: Senior Family Financial Aid Advising Day Nov 27
OCEAN will be hosting a Financial Aid Advising Day on November 27th, 1-3pm during students Path to Graduation Class and after school at 5pm for parents to get more information and complete the FSA ID portion of the Financial Aid Application. We are working with community partners Krista DeHart with NW Washington STEM Network and Abby Rand with Peninsula College to support in this process.
Our volunteers will come in and describe the new process for applying and setting up their FSA ID number which is necessary for applications. Students will need to know or bring their social security number to start this process. Parents also need a FSA ID to complete their part of the application and will need their social security number as well. ASVAB Test - October 26
The ASVAB is being offered at OCEAN on October 26th starting at 12:00pm and there is no cost to take it.
ASVAB stands for Armed Services Vocational Aptitude Battery, and is designed to measure abilities and predict future academic and occupational success in the military. If you are considering a military career, it is a requirement to take and pass the ASVAB.
Even if you do not plan a military career, it can be helpful to support students in learning their strengths, exploring potential career options, and it can satisfy the Graduation Pathway which is a high school graduation requirement.
